Key Points from Jerome Powell’s Recent Press Conference

Jerome Powell, the chair of the Federal Reserve, recently held a press conference where he discussed several important topics affecting the economy and the financial system. Here are four main points from his remarks.

Economic Concerns and Inflation

One of the key issues Powell addressed was inflation. He noted that while inflation has been decreasing, it remains a concern for both consumers and policymakers. The Fed is committed to managing inflation to ensure economic stability.

Powell also talked about the ongoing conflict between Israel and Iran, highlighting how geopolitical tensions can impact global markets. He emphasized that the Federal Reserve is closely monitoring these developments as they could influence economic conditions in the U.S.

Additionally, Powell touched on the legal challenges facing the Fed, stating that these issues have not distracted the organization from its main goal of maintaining a healthy economy. He reassured the public that the Fed’s independence is crucial for effective monetary policy.

Finally, Powell mentioned the Fed’s future plans. He indicated that any decisions regarding interest rates would be based on incoming economic data, emphasizing the Fed’s data-driven approach. He urged Americans to remain calm and focused on economic indicators, as the Fed will adapt its policies as needed to support growth.
